A Leading Name in Commercial Refrigeration

True Manufacturing is one of the major names in commercial refrigeration, built specifically for the demands of professional foodservice rather than home kitchens. Based in Missouri, True has spent decades manufacturing reach-in refrigerators and freezers, glass-door merchandisers, undercounter units, and prep tables that form the backbone of cold storage in restaurants, bars, convenience stores, and grocery operations across the country. It's an industry-standard name alongside brands like Traulsen and Beverage-Air, and it's common enough as a kitchen-design specification that many commercial kitchen blueprints simply call out a True model number as the default rather than listing generic requirements for a bidder to fill.

True's engineering reputation is built on consistent temperature performance and durability under continuous commercial operation - equipment that's expected to run 24 hours a day, every day, without the kind of downtime a restaurant or bar simply can't absorb, holding tight temperature tolerances that matter both for food quality and for health-code compliance. That reliability focus, more than any consumer-facing feature, is what has made True a default specification in commercial kitchen design for so long, and it's why the brand carries real weight with kitchen designers and equipment dealers even though most home cooks have never heard the name.

True's product range also includes specialized categories beyond standard reach-ins - blast chillers for rapid food cooling to meet health-code safety requirements, specialty wine and beverage merchandising units, and food-service display cases - reflecting how the company has expanded to cover essentially every commercial cold-storage need a foodservice operation might have as its business has scaled up over the decades. That breadth is part of why True so often ends up as the single specified brand across an entire commercial kitchen's refrigeration needs rather than one piece among several different manufacturers.

True's Presence in Houston's Restaurant and Hospitality Industry

Houston's sizable restaurant and hospitality sector - driven heavily by tourism around the Montrose, downtown convention business, and a broad base of independent and chain restaurants - runs a substantial amount of commercial refrigeration, and True is one of the most consistently specified brands in that installed base. We see it in everything from reach-in coolers in back-of-house kitchens to glass-door beverage merchandisers on the front-of-house floor, and in banquet and catering kitchens tied to the city's convention center and hotel event business, where refrigeration demand spikes sharply around large bookings.

This is squarely commercial equipment servicing rather than residential appliance repair, and we treat it that way - our commercial technicians work directly with restaurant operators, kitchen managers, and facilities staff who need clear communication about downtime, health-code refrigeration temperature requirements, and realistic repair timelines, because a broken walk-in or reach-in isn't just an inconvenience, it's a food safety and revenue issue on the clock. Health inspectors care about holding temperatures, and an operator with a struggling reach-in needs a technician who understands both the mechanical problem and the compliance stakes.

Grocery and convenience retail operations around Houston also run True equipment heavily, particularly glass-door merchandisers for beverages and prepared foods, which puts a different kind of demand on the equipment than a restaurant's back-of-house reach-in - constant customer-facing door traffic, extended operating hours, and a strict expectation that product stays visibly well-organized and properly chilled at all times for the retail floor. Servicing that category requires the same technical competence as any True call, with an added layer of attention to the customer-facing presentation the equipment has to maintain.

Failure Patterns We Track on True Equipment

Compressor and condenser performance issues top our True service log, frequently tied to condenser coil fouling from kitchen grease and heat exposure - a maintenance issue as much as an equipment one, and one of the most preventable causes of a True unit underperforming or failing outright. Door gasket wear on reach-ins and glass-door units is the second most common call, particularly on high-traffic units that get opened dozens or hundreds of times per shift during peak service, which accelerates gasket fatigue well beyond what a residential refrigerator ever experiences.

Evaporator fan motor failures and thermostat or control issues round out the majority of our True calls. Because True units run continuously in commercial settings, our internal data consistently shows that accounts on a regular preventive maintenance schedule - condenser cleaning, gasket inspection - have measurably fewer emergency calls than accounts that only call when something has already failed, which is a pattern we see across essentially every commercial refrigeration brand but that's especially worth flagging on equipment as central to a kitchen's operation as True typically is.

We also track compressor age and run-hours where accounts allow it, since a True compressor nearing the end of its expected service life often shows subtle signs - slightly longer run cycles, marginally higher energy draw - before it fails outright, and catching that pattern during a routine maintenance visit lets an operator plan a replacement on their own schedule rather than during an emergency. That kind of proactive flagging is part of what separates a maintenance visit that's just a cleaning from one that actually extends the useful life of the equipment.

We also see occasional issues with electronic controllers on newer True models that have moved toward more digital temperature management compared to older analog thermostat designs, though these failures are still notably less frequent than the mechanical and maintenance-related issues that dominate our call volume. Digital control boards, when they do fail, tend to fail cleanly - the unit either loses temperature control entirely or displays a clear fault code - which actually makes diagnosis more straightforward than a marginal analog thermostat that's drifting gradually out of calibration without triggering an obvious symptom. And on walk-in cooler and freezer installations that pair True condensing units with custom box construction, we occasionally trace a reported cooling complaint back to door seal or panel-seam issues in the walk-in structure itself rather than the True equipment, which is why our diagnostic always starts with confirming where in the system a problem actually originates.
